Are you still on the contacts tab, with its T9-style pad? When I switch to the search tab, search by company is the first selection in the pick-list, and it works okay for me.
Switch to the search tab how, from where? In Star Contacts or normal Contacts?
In StarContact, I have four tabs at the top of the screen: Contacts - Phone - Call log - Search.
On the Search screen, there is a field for keyword entry, a "Search By:" pick-list, and a Search button. The pick-list offers Company, Phone Number, Email, IM, Address, and Note
